Mubarak to receive Pope John Paul II
Egypt-Vatican, Politics, 2/23/2000
President Mubarak will receive Pope John Paul II of Vatican, who is expected in Cairo on Thursday. The talks will focus on the Middle East peace process, future of the regain and bilateral relations.
President Mubarak will deliver an address to welcome the pontiff.
Pope John Paul, in his address, will greet Egyptian people.
The Pontiff will meet Pope Shenouda III of Saint Mark Diocese and Grand Imam of Al Azhar Dr. Mohamed Sayed Tantawi.
Egypt's Ambassador to the Vatican Hussein Al-Sadr Tuesday described visit by Pope John Paul II to Egypt as a testimony on the religious tolerance Egypt has been experiencing over the past 14 centuries.
In statements to Radio Sawt Al-Arab over the phone from the Vatican, the Ambassador said that the Pope's visit and his meeting with President Hosni Mubarak acquire special significance as it will be the first visit ever by a Pope of the Vatican to Egypt and also because it takes place at a crucial stage in the Middle East peace process.
